Template:Discussion page: Difference between revisions

From Valve Developer Community
Jump to navigation Jump to search
(Testing completed, changes reverted until a non-copy of Discord is finalized)
(Awaited change addressing current flaws isn't coming. Replaced template with a variant from the discussion: put text on two lines in a metanotice, added optional Expand for archives, tried to give it a color with recognition value for discussions.)
Line 1: Line 1:
{{Notify
{{#if:{{{archives|}}}|{{Expand|<!-- need newline for lists -->
| text = <div style="font-weight:600; font-size:1.25; color:rgb(255 255 255 / 90%)"> Archived template </div>
{{{archives}}}|title=[[File:Icon-folder open.png|14px|baseline|link=]] {{/strings|Archives}}
This template has been placed in the archive until better times. It may still be useful to standardize the discussion pages and reduce the number of templates used in them.
|float=right|color=rgb(157,224,224)|startcollapsed=0|style=margin:2em; margin-top:0; padding-right:2em}}
}}
}}<!--
<includeonly><onlyinclude>{{#ifeq:{{FULLPAGENAME}}|Template:Discussion page||{{DISPLAYTITLE:<span style=display:none>{{{title|{{#ifeq:{{NAMESPACE}}|User talk|{{Discussion page/strings|UserTalk}}{{{user|{{PAGENAME}}}}}|{{FULLPAGENAME}}}}}}}</span>|noerror}}}}<div><!--
 
-->{{#if:{{{archives|}}}|<div style="float:right;padding:10px;color:white;text-align:right;width:50%;max-height:700px;overflow:auto><span style=color:rgb(255,255,255);font-size:25px;font-weight:bold;>Archives</span><br>{{expand|startcollapsed={{#switch:{{{collapsearchives|}}}|1|true=1|false|0=0|#default=1}}|noborder=1|style=text-align:left;float:right;|1={{{archives}}}}}</div>|}}<!--
-->{{metanotice
--><div style="display:flex; flex-direction:column; gap:12px; float:left width:{{#if:{{{archives|}}}|50|100}}%; background:{{{background|linear-gradient(180deg, #262626 30%, transparent 0)}}}; position:relative; z-index:80; margin-top:{{#ifeq:{{FULLPAGENAME}}|Template:Discussion page|0|calc(-27px - {{{up|{{#ifeq:{{ROOTPAGENAME}}|{{SUBPAGENAME}}|0|20}}}}}px)}}; margin-bottom:{{#ifeq:{{FULLPAGENAME}}|Template:Discussion page|0|26px}}">
|id=[[File:Icon-message-48px.png|32px|link=]]
<div style="{{text-dir|rtl=flex-direction:row-reverse;}} display:flex; align-items:center; gap:14px;">
|rgb=157,224,224
<div style="display:flex; align-items:center; justify-content:center; user-select:none; pointer-events:none; min-width:68px; min-height:68px; border-radius:16px; background-color:hsl(0 0% 100% / 15%)">[[File:Icon-message-48px.png|link=]]</div>
|text=This is the [[Help:Discussion|discussion page]] of {{code|{{ARTICLEPAGENAME}}}}. '''Please sign your comments with {{code|<nowiki>~~~~</nowiki>}}.'''<br>
<div {{text-dir|rtl=align="right"}}>
<small>To add a comment, use the '''Edit''' button near the headline of the appropriate section. To create a new section, you can use the '''Add topic''' button at the top of this page.</small>
<div style="line-height:1.2em; color:#FFF; font-size:30px">'''{{Discussion page/strings|Welcome}}'''</div>
}}<!--
<div style="font-size:14px">{{{description|{{Discussion page/strings|Desc}}}}}</div>
 
</div>
--><noinclude><!--
</div>
 
<div style="{{text-dir|rtl=flex-direction:row-reverse;}} display:flex; font-size:14px; gap:8px"><!--
-->{{doc}}
-->[[Help:Discussion|<font style="display:flex; align-items:center; user-select:none; background-color:hsl(0 0% 100% / 4%); border-radius:4px; color:lightgrey; padding:6px 8px">{{Discussion page/strings|Doc}}</font>]] <!--
--><span class="plainlinks">[{{fullurl:{{FULLPAGENAME}}|action=edit&section=new&preload=Template:Discussion_page/preload}} <font style="display:flex; align-items:center; user-select:none; padding:6px 8px; border-radius:4px; background:hsl(0 0% 100% / 4%); color:lightgrey">{{Discussion page/strings|AddTopic}}</font>]</span>
</div>
{{#if:{{{answer|}}}
|<div class="plainlinks" style="{{text-dir|rtl=flex-direction:row-reverse;}} display:flex; gap:4px; align-items:center; background-color:hsl(220 100% 50% / 4%); border:2px solid hsl(220 100% 60%); border-radius:4px; padding:6px 8px">{{Discussion page/strings|NewAnswer}}[[{{{answer}}}|<font style="color:#FFF">{{{answer}}}</font>]]</div>
|}}
</div></div></onlyinclude></includeonly>

Revision as of 11:52, 24 July 2024

Icon-message-48px.png
This is the discussion page of Template:Discussion page. Please sign your comments with ~~~~.
To add a comment, use the Edit button near the headline of the appropriate section. To create a new section, you can use the Add topic button at the top of this page.
English (en)Deutsch (de)Esperanto (eo)Español (es)Français (fr)Suomi (fi)Hrvatski (hr)Magyar (hu)Italiano (it)日本語 (ja)한국어 (ko)Nederlands (nl)Polski (pl)Português (pt)Português do Brasil (pt-br)Русский (ru)Slovenčina (sk)Svenska (sv)Türkçe (tr)Українська (uk)Tiếng Việt (vi)中文 (zh)中文(臺灣) (zh-tw)
Curly brackets white.pngTemplate Documentation [view] [edit]
Icon-translate.png Available doc translations
View
Page history
Icon-translate.png
This template uses a strings subpage
Please follow the format on this subpage(s) to add translations.
Number of strings:7
Approximate status of translation:English (en) 100% Esperanto (eo) 85.71% Suomi (fi) 100% Русский (ru) 100% Tiếng Việt (vi) 85.71% 中文 (zh) 85.71% 

This template is used at the top of all talk pages.

Usage

{{discussion page}} Hello, World!

 ↓

Icon-message-48px.png
This is the discussion page of Template:Discussion page. Please sign your comments with ~~~~.
To add a comment, use the Edit button near the headline of the appropriate section. To create a new section, you can use the Add topic button at the top of this page.
Hello, World!



{{discussion page|archives= * Hello, * World! }} Hello, World!

 ↓

Icon-folder open.png 1 = Archives
  • Hello,
  • World!
Icon-message-48px.png
This is the discussion page of Template:Discussion page. Please sign your comments with ~~~~.
To add a comment, use the Edit button near the headline of the appropriate section. To create a new section, you can use the Add topic button at the top of this page.
Hello, World!

Parameters

  • {{{archives}}} - Archives of previous discussions inside an {{Expand}} box.

Included Subpages

Below are the subpages that are used by this template for better code readability or something else.

  • /preload - This is the pre-load content that appears used to appear on the edit interface after the user clicks the Add Topic/Reply button.
  • /strings - This subpage includes the translatable strings that the template has used.